Spotting Fake News: Tips and Tricks to Stay Informed
Alright, so we know fake news is out there and it's a problem, but how do we actually spot it? It can be tricky, especially since these hoaxsters are getting more and more sophisticated in their methods. But don't worry, there are some key things you can look for to help you separate the truth from the fiction. First, check the source. Is the news coming from a reputable news organization with a history of accurate reporting, or is it from some website you've never heard of? A quick Google search of the source can often reveal if it's known for spreading misinformation. Second, pay attention to the headline. Sensational, clickbait-y headlines are a major red flag. If it sounds too unbelievable, it probably is. Third, look at the evidence. Does the story cite any sources? Are there any quotes from credible people? If the story is vague and lacks concrete details, that's a warning sign. Fourth, do a little digging. Search for the same story on other news sites. If major news outlets aren't reporting it, that's a pretty good indication it's not true. Finally, use fact-checking websites. Sites like Snopes and PolitiFact are dedicated to debunking fake news and can be invaluable resources. Remember, it's always better to be safe than sorry when it comes to sharing information. Take a few extra seconds to verify a story before you hit that share button – you'll be doing your part to stop the spread of misinformation. We got this, team!
Hulk Hogan's Enduring Legacy: More Than Just a Wrestler
Now that we've cleared up the fake news, let's shift gears and talk about the real deal: Hulk Hogan's incredible legacy. This guy is more than just a wrestler; he's a cultural icon. Think about it – Hulkamania was a global phenomenon. He captivated millions with his charisma, his catchphrases, and his larger-than-life persona. For many, he was the face of professional wrestling in the 80s and 90s, a time when the sport reached new heights of popularity. But his impact goes beyond the ring. Hulk Hogan became a symbol of American heroism, embodying the values of hard work, determination, and never giving up. His "Hulk Up" routine, where he would absorb his opponent's attacks and then unleash his own power, was a powerful metaphor for overcoming adversity. And let's not forget his connection with his fans. Hulk Hogan always made time for his Hulkamaniacs, signing autographs, posing for pictures, and making personal appearances. He understood the importance of connecting with his audience, and that's a big part of why he's remained so popular for so long. Of course, his career hasn't been without its controversies, but his overall impact on the world of entertainment is undeniable.
